LE TEMPS EN FRANÇAIS ET EN ÉTSÀKỌ : ETUDE CONTRASTIVE ET IMPLICATIONS PEDAGOGIQUES

Journal Title: The Journal of International Social Research - Year 2014, Vol 7, Issue 29

Abstract

The study of tenses can be done from two perspectives: grammatical and semantic. In this article, our viewpoint is grammatical. We present a contrastive analysis of tenses in French and Étsàkọ̀ within the framework of the Strong Minimalist Thesis, the 2007 model of Noam Chomsky’s Principles and Parameters Approach of Generative Grammar. The pedagogical implications of our findings, arising from the contrastive analysis, for the teaching of French tenses to native speakers of Étsàkọ̀ language in particular, and of other related languages, in general, are also discussed.
